Senior Construction Claims Analyst

We are seeking a Senior Construction Claims Analyst to serve as a key contributor within the firm's Claims Group, supporting complex claims and dispute resolution efforts across major capital programs. This senior-level role is responsible for leading claims strategy, forensic schedule analysis, and cost/damages evaluation for public and private sector clients.

The Senior Construction Claims Analyst serves as a senior advisor to client stakeholders, legal counsel, and project leadership teams on matters involving delay, disruption, acceleration, change order entitlement, productivity impacts, cost recovery, and contract risk. This role requires deep expertise in construction claims, CPM scheduling, project controls, estimating, and negotiation strategies across complex transportation, transit, infrastructure, power, water/wastewater, and vertical construction environments.

The ideal candidate brings a combination of technical depth, strategic judgment, and executive presence, with demonstrated success leading high-risk claims assignments, advising major public agencies, and influencing outcomes in highly visible project environments.

Organizational Responsibilities

Claims Strategy & Leadership

  • Defines and leads claims strategy across major project disputes, aligning technical analysis, contractual entitlement, cost exposure, constructability, and risk mitigation objectives.
  • Serves as a Senior Claims Advisor to executive leadership, client executives, legal counsel, and project leadership teams on highly complex dispute matters.
  • Establishes claims positioning strategies and resolution pathways for large, multi-party disputes involving owners, contractors, consultants, and external counsel.
  • Provides leadership in high-risk negotiations, executive claims reviews, and dispute governance discussions often involving major public infrastructure and transportation programs.
  • Mentors junior analysts and project controls professionals in claims development, forensic schedule analysis, constructability, and technical writing.
  • Contributes to the development of internal methodologies, training tools, and technical standards related to claims, estimating, and project controls.
  • Participates in industry forums, technical associations, and professional discussions related to claims, scheduling, estimating, constructability, and dispute resolution.
  • Supports strategic business development efforts involving claims advisory, dispute services, and risk consulting opportunities.
  • Provides senior technical leadership in claims management systems, standards, and best practices across the organization.

Identifying & Documenting Claims

  • Leads early identification of potential claims exposure across active programs through contract review, schedule analysis, cost evaluation, and project controls assessment.
  • Advises clients and internal teams on proactive claims avoidance, documentation standards, entitlement positioning, and opportunities that may reduce downstream dispute exposure.
  • Reviews contract language, schedule provisions, procurement strategies, and project delivery methods to identify claims risk.
  • Supports executive workshops and technical advisory sessions focused on early warning systems, dispute prevention, mitigation, and contract management strategies.

Developing and Analyzing Claims

  • Directs and reviews both 1) the development of a claim on behalf of a claimant and 2) reviews and analyzes claims submitted by a claimant, on highly complex claims involving delay, disruption, acceleration, loss of productivity, cumulative impact, differing site conditions, and termination issues.
  • Leads forensic CPM schedule analysis, including proficiency in using Oracle Primavera, P6, and familiarity with Microsoft Project Planner, to evaluate delay responsibility, critical path impacts, phasing constraints, and time entitlement.
  • Oversees preparation and review of cost damages analyses, independent cost evaluations, change order pricing, engineer's estimates, and cost-to-complete assessments.
  • Integrate scheduling, estimating, project controls, constructability, and contract analysis into comprehensive claims evaluations.
  • Supports claims analysis on large, complex public and private projects, and capital programs involving multi-contract interfaces and phased delivery environments.
  • Reviews and approves major client deliverables, expert support documentation, and litigation support materials.
  • Supports the preparation of technical findings of facts, used in mediation, arbitration, litigation, and negotiated settlement environments.

Resolving / Negotiating Claims

  • Leads and supports negotiations involving major change orders, extension-of-time requests, disputed cost recovery matters, and contractor entitlement issues.
  • Partners directly with outside counsel, insurers, executive stakeholders, and project leadership teams to support favorable resolution strategies.
  • Supports mediation, arbitration, and formal dispute resolution proceedings through technical leadership and claims advisory expertise.
  • Develops practical resolution frameworks balancing commercial outcomes, schedule recovery, and client objectives.
Position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ree required in Engineering, Construction Management, Civil Engineering, or related technical discipline. An advanced degree is strongly preferred.
  • 15+ years of progressive experience in construction claims, forensic schedule analysis, project controls, cost estimating, constructability, and dispute advisory across major capital programs.
  • Licensed Professional Engineer (PE) strongly preferred.
  • Demonstrated expertise using Oracle Primavera P6 for forensic schedule analysis, delay modeling, and entitlement evaluation.
  • Proven experience analyzing and advising on claims, change orders, extension-of-time matters, and contract disputes involving projects valued at $20M+.
  • Strong experience supporting both public and private clients on various projects ranging from transportation, energy, education, and healthcare facilities.
  • Demonstrated experience in preparing and evaluating contractor pricing, supporting value engineering studies, and reviewing change order valuations.
  • Strong executive communication skills with experience presenting findings to senior client leadership, boards, or executive stakeholders.
  • Professional certifications or affiliations such as CCP, PMP, PE, FRICS, or active participation in the Association for the Advancement of Cost Engineering are strongly preferred.
  • Demonstrated leadership in multidisciplinary environments involving legal counsel, technical teams, and senior client stakeholders.
